Ceci est une page optimisée pour les mobiles. Cliquez sur ce texte pour afficher la vraie page.

Vlookup ? formule ?

  • Initiateur de la discussion Initiateur de la discussion xt3nce
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

X

xt3nce

Guest
Salutations,
Dans le cadre de mon travail, je dois effectuer des cotations de fond de placement. Pour ce faire je vais soit sur bloomberg, soit je recherche ces valeurs dans un fichier xls qu'une banque m'envoi par mail tout les jours.

Cependant ce fichier est trés volimineux (car comportant plus de 1000 fonds) et donc par facilité je vais rechercher ces valeurs sur internet.

Dans ce fichier, on peut y trouver le code ISIN du fond, son promoter, la categorie legaée, le nom du fond, sa valeur, sa devise etc ...

Voici de maniere simplifié comment est ce fichier (volontairement simplifié et raccourci).


LU0119118205 Equity Consumer Goods Europe Capitalisation 106,9 EUR
LU0119118205 Equity Consumer Goods Europe Capitalisation 150,42 USD
LU0119119195 Equity Consumer Goods Europe Distribution 86,71 EUR
LU0119119195 Equity Consumer Goods Europe Distribution 122,01 USD
LU0159030666 Equity Consumer Goods Europe (P) Capitalisation 72,17 EUR
LU0159030666 Equity Consumer Goods Europe (P) Capitalisation 101,55 USD
LU0377077325 Equity Germany Capitalisation 129,6 EUR
LU0377077325 Equity Germany Capitalisation 1402,25 SEK
LU0377077325 Equity Germany Capitalisation 182,37 USD

Donc dans ma premiere page Excel j'aurais ces données, et j'aimerais dans ma seconde page Excel creer une formule pour aler chercher directement la valeur des fonds. Disons que je veuille afficher la valeur du fond " Equity Consumer Goods Europe Capitalisation " , en devise EUR , en incluant dans cette formule L'isin (LU0119118205) (par soucis de vérification, étant donné qu'il y a plusieurs fond du même nom mais avec different ISIN ), comment faire ?
Je ne sais pas si j'ai été trés claire, en tout cas si je dois réexpliquer un points n'hesitez pas à me demander, ce fichier pourrais me faire avancer bien plus vite dans mon travail quotidien 🙂
 
Re : Vlookup ? formule ?

Bonjour,

Les données d'une ligne sont-elles dans une seule ou dans plusieurs cellules ?
Avec ton exemple en pièce jointe ce serait plus facile pour essayer de te trouver une solution.
 
Re : Vlookup ? formule ?

Bonjour,

Les données d'une ligne sont-elles dans une seule ou dans plusieurs cellules ?
Avec ton exemple en pièce jointe ce serait plus facile pour essayer de te trouver une solution.

Les données ne sont pas dans une même cellule.

Il y a une colone pour l'isin, une pour le nom du fond, une pour la devise etc...
 
Re : Vlookup ? formule ?

Re,

Si tu précises le "etc...", au moyen d'un exemple en pièce jointe, et que tu précises aussi pourquoi tu ne parviens pas à adapter la formule que je t'ai proposée en pièce jointe, c'est bien volontiers que j'essaierai de t'aider.
 
Re : Vlookup ? formule ?

Voici le fichier que je reçoi ( j'ai enlevé une trés grande partie des donnée étant donné qu'il est trop volumineux sinon ) .

Dans la premiere page c'est les donnée que je reçois, et j'aimerais donc que la réponse apparaisse dans la case violette de la seconde page.

Mais il faut que ce soit fait avec une fonction de recherche, étant donné que les lignes de la page une ne sont pas fixe vu qu'il y a de nouveau fond tout les jours, et d'autres qui ne sont plus dans le fichier ..

Dsl pour la complexité de ma requete :/
 

Pièces jointes

Re : Vlookup ? formule ?

Merci beaucoup à tous pour votre aide !

je vais voir de mon coté une fois que j'ai du temps si celà correspond bien à mes attentes une fois que j'importerai toutes mes données.

je vous tiens au courant.

Encore merci !
 
Re : Vlookup ? formule ?

=INDIRECT("Sheet1!D"&MATCH(A2&B2&F2;Sheet1!A$1:A$33&Sheet1!B$1:B$33&Sheet1!E$1:E$33;0))

Si j'essaye de comprendre cette formule, , elle va voir si A2 B2 F2 de la page 2 correspond aux données de la colonne A B et F de la page 1, et si c'est le cas alors elle m'affiche la réponse de la page 1 (colonne D) c'est bien ça ?
 
Re : Vlookup ? formule ?

Re,

Exact !

La fonction MATCH (EQUIV en français) renvoie le numéro de la ligne dans laquelle la concaténation des trois critères est trouvée.
En précédant cette valeur numérique du nom de la feuille et de la lettre de la colonne dans laquelle se trouve la valeur cherchée, INDIRECT renvoie cette valeur.
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D
Assurez vous de marquer un message comme solution pour une meilleure transparence.
Les cookies sont requis pour utiliser ce site. Vous devez les accepter pour continuer à utiliser le site. En savoir plus…